WebApr 1, 2011 · A Cat-II tracing is neither normal nor definitively abnormal. Namely: If FHR accelerations or moderate variability are detected, the fetus is unlikely to be currently acidemic. If fetal heart accelerations are absent and variability is absent or minimal, the risk of fetal acidemia increases. Cat-II tracings should be monitored closely and ... WebA reactive non-stress result indicates that blood flow (and oxygen) to the fetus is adequate. A nonreactive non-stress result requires additional testing to determine whether the result is truly due to poor oxygenation, or whether there are other reasons for fetal non-reactivity (i.e. sleep patterns, certain maternal prescription or ...
